Editors’ Review
Personno, developed by personno, is a web-based AI market research platform that replaces human panels with synthetic respondents to accelerate hypothesis testing and product validation. The app generates responses from a database of millions of AI-crafted digital twins, automates surveys, and produces analytics on branding, UX flows, and ads. It offers rapid, directional results through an analytics dashboard and multi-asset testing tools. Market researchers, product managers, and marketing teams can use it to iterate ideas faster and reduce recruitment overhead.
What tasks can you actually use it for?
The tool targets market research tasks where synthetic respondent sampling replaces live panels. It supports multi-asset testing for product designs, marketing copy, and video ads, plus user journey simulation to surface funnel friction. Use cases include rapid concept validation, branding comparison, and UX flow analysis. Output is delivered as structured reports and dashboards that summarize cohort preferences and regional trends for decision-making.
How reliable are the generated insights?
The model produces directional insights by generating responses from millions of AI-modeled digital twins trained on consumer behavior datasets. The developer is cited in industry listings for high predictive accuracy, but the tool generates outputs based on its training data, so businesses should verify findings before making regulated or high-stakes decisions. Consistency is positioned as higher than fatigued human panels, according to platform claims.
What input and platform requirements limit its use?
The app runs as a cloud-based web application accessible via major browsers including Chrome, Firefox, Safari, and Edge, and does not require local software or specialized hardware. The platform's SaaS hosting means data and survey payloads are processed on external servers. That architecture enables near-instant results but also calls for organizational review of data handling and compliance policies before uploading sensitive material.
Is it practical to fit into existing research workflows?
The app automates survey runs and delivers an analytics dashboard that summarizes consumer preferences, regional trends, and sentiment analysis, which aligns with the needs of market researchers and product managers. The developer also operates KNWN Studio and provides integration paths to connect business data via Model Context Protocol servers. Teams should plan confirmatory human testing when qualitative nuance or legal compliance is required.

Bottom Line
Best suited to fast iteration rather than final validation
The tool is a practical option for market researchers and product teams who prioritize speed and iterative learning; its outputs function as preliminary evidence rather than final answers. Organizations should incorporate a confirmatory step led by human research when decisions carry legal, safety, or reputational risk. Using automated results to narrow hypotheses and then confirming them with targeted human work makes the platform most useful.
